Yesterday, I decided to sit down and sort out the giant mess that is my WEAPONDATA. I deleted a bunch of duplicates and stuff I didn't need, and was about half-way through reorganizing it so that I could actually find stuff. I dropped it into WOI, and now the game crashes on start-up. Ugh.

 

Was it something that I did? I used the WOI weapons editor, and I didn't do anything besides using the moveup/movedown buttons, delete and save. I never touched anything with the text editor. After the crash, I looked at it in notepad, and nothing looks out of whack. The only thing that I can think of is that I need to open and close all the weapons now that I moved them, but I thought that was only so that could be used in game, not to keep the whole game from crashing.

 

Has this happened to anybody else? Is this a known issue I just don't know about? Any ideas about what to do?

 

And yes, I did back it up before I started. I still have a good WEAPONSDATA, its just the same mess its always been.

Posted

Did you remove any of the default weapons? I have noticed that is you do that, it will crash the sim.

Posted

wow, here's a coupla ideas to try:

 

1) extract stock weaponsdata ini; add the weapons you want, do the add weapons ini dance.

2) D/L the TMF weapons pak; add the weapons you want do the add weapons ini dance.

 

Both/either will fix the problem
